An incumbent State Senator has won another term, while a newcomer in the Iowa House has maintained a primary election victory.
In the new District 19, Republican Ken Rozenboom defeated Democrat Tyler Stewart by a margin of 18,115 (68.6%) to 8,282 (31.35%) in the newly drawn district representing most of Marion Counties and Jasper County, as west as Mahaska County west of Oskaloosa.
In House District 37, Barb Kniff-McCulla, a Republican, defeated Democrat Mike Overman with 10,590 votes (74.6%) to 3,590 (25.3%).
